The Hsiung-nu were a nomadic pastoralist group in ancient China. They were known for their military skill and often raided the Chinese border. They posed a significant threat to the Han Dynasty, and Emperor Wudi launched several campaigns against them, although he was not successful. The Hsiung-nu had a destabilizing effect on Wudi's reign, leading to increased military spending and a focus on strengthening the Great Wall for defense.

Emperor Wudi strengthened China's government by centralizing authority, expanding bureaucracy, and implementing policies to control the economy and military. He also promoted education and culture, contributing to the stability and prosperity of the Han Dynasty.
